Chronic pelvic pain syndrome and the overactive bladder: the inflammatory link.

Rajiv Saini1, Ricardo R Gonzalez, Alexis E Te.   

Abstract

Although the causes of chronic prostatitis/chronic pelvic pain syndrome, painful bladder syndrome/interstitial cystitis, and overactive bladder remain unclear, inflammation may explain some of the causative and propagating features. Cytokines may play a role by recruiting inflammatory cells and ultimately in inducing symptoms. This paper reviews the role of cytokines in the pathophysiology of chronic prostatitis/chronic pelvic pain syndrome, overactive bladder, and painful bladder syndrome/interstitial cystitis.
